At 20 cm high, the mini hip joint from 3B Scientific is about half the size of a human hip joint. A cross-section is shown on the base of the joint model, which depicts not only the external structures of the joint but also the inner workings. The mini-model is kept functional in its movement possibilities. With the cross section of the joint, the inside of the joint can also be explained to patients in detail. Mini hip joint about 20 cm high with cross section of the joint shown on the base Size: 16 x 12 x 20 cm Weight: 0,29 kg Scope of delivery Mini hip joint on base

The mini elbow joint from 3B Scientific is about half the size of a natural elbow joint. The joint model is functionally oriented in its movement possibilities and shows not only the external structures but also a cross-section on the base. With the joint cross-section, the inner workings of the large joint can be studied and explained in detail. Mini elbow joint about 20 cm high with cross section of the joint shown on the base Size: 16 x 12 x 20 cm Weight: 0,24 kg Scope of delivery Mini elbow joint on base
